Mayer Brown announced that Chicago-based ERISA Litigation partner Nancy Ross has been named to The National Law Journal’s (NLJ) list of “Employment Law Trailblazers.” This inaugural list recognizes “agents of change” – legal professionals who have impacted employment law and the overall legal industry through new types of strategies and innovative court cases. A co-leader of the firm’s ERISA Litigation practice, Ms. Ross was selected by NLJ for her impressive work representing clients in employee benefits disputes. NLJ highlighted several of Ms. Ross’ important ERISA cases, including one quashing an attempt at state regulation of benefits plans. Successfully arguing before the Second Circuit that ERISA preempted a Vermont law requiring her client to disclose confidential employee information, and paving the way for confirmation by the US Supreme Court, Ms. Ross prompted “one of the leading cases in ERISA preemption and caused many other states to forgo similar statutes, helping promote ERISA uniformity nationwide.” The publication also recognized her work with the nation’s unions to achieve “win-win situations where employers can continue to provide retiree health benefits but also sustain jobs.”
